Transaction 3cfccdbcdbb2571ae8024e31005b6020892f67b890d73a46211a6d50c6f5c651
1 Input
1 Output
-
3cfccdbcdbb2571ae8024e31005b6020892f67b890d73a46211a6d50c6f5c651:0
- value
- 11091830
- script pubkey
- OP_0 OP_PUSHBYTES_20 50d7ea5faeaacb5a34aab77e8e3d4445ecb72c0d
- address
- ltc1q2rt75haw4t945d92kalgu02yghktwtqd2esk2z